Arithmetic Sequence: is a sequence where each term is just the previous term plus a constant.
The constant is called the Common Difference
How to identify an arithmetic sequence...
Are these arithmetic? If so, what is the common difference?
ex) 2, 5, 8, 11, ...
ex) 10, 4, ­1, ­3, ...
ex) 91.4, 83.1, 74.8, 66.5, Geometric Sequence: a sequence where each term is just the previous term multiplied by a constant.
The constant is called the common ratio
or the common multiplier

These sequences are all RECURSIVE.
Recursion: where each step of a pattern is dependent on the step or steps before it.
Recursive Formula­ Creates a sequence. It contains the following pieces:
Starting value:
Recursive rule:
Condition:
The first number in the series.
defines the n th term in
relation to the previous term (or terms)
tells which values of n the rule will work for.
u0 or u1

ex) 5, 20, 80, ___ , ___ , ___
Recursive Routine
u1 = 5
un = un­1 x 4
On your home screen type the following
5 enter
ans x 4 enter, enter, enter...
You MUST count how many iterations you
have done.
Use this to find the 15th term! _________
What if I don't want to count or
loose track while counting?
Unit 10 Day 1 ­ Geometric Sequences
ex) 5, 20, 80, ___ , ___ , ____
Recursive Routine
u1 = 5
un = un­1 x 4
Enter the starting term and value on your calculator like this:
{1, 5} then press enter.
Next, enter this:
{Ans (1)+1, Ans (2) x 4}
And keep hitting enter until you get to the term you need.
